U15 match report.

Longford U15’s 22 Midlands Warriors 17

U15’s welcomed Midlands Warriors for a Thursday night Leinster league game under lights.

We were under immediate pressure from the start and managed to push the warriors out to halfway from our own 5m. A couple of sloppy tackles allowed them take a 0-5 lead shortly after.

Longford took the game by the scruff and hit back with Donnacha Golden and Daniel Corr both scoring before a punt through from Shane MacGuigan put Darragh Walsh into space for the third.

In a very industrious performance, Derek Belton bloke clear down the left to round the defensive and score the last try, his fourth in four games. The warriors piled on the pressure for the remainder of the game, by trucking up the middle with their 3 u16’s really working hard to claw their way back into the game. They got within 5 points and a huge and committed defensive effort from the Longford boys was required to hold them out to claim the win. The reaction at the final whistle was ecstatic for the lads. We were without 3 key players yet again but those on the park really worked hard for the win. The handling and fast line speed was improved showing them how good they can play when the focus is on point.

Next match is a Leinster league fixture at home to Arklow 1.00pm Saturday.

U18’s match report

Longford U18’s 37 Cill Dara 15

Longford U18s travelled to Cill Dara for a Leinster League game and came home with the 4 points in the bag.

We welcomed back Cormac McDonagh who marked his return with three tries and was joined on the scoreboard with 5 pointers from Oliver Kuponyi, captain Cormac Casey, John Boyle and Dan Crossan. It was pleasing to see the work put in by coaches Danny and Roy begin to have an impact.

Next game is home vs Arklow on Saturday
